Another attack on the Museum

27.06.2024.

On June 26, at about 4.30 PM, a woman in a state of possible alcoholic intoxication partly tore off 3 of the 8 large photographs of the photo exhibition "Portraits of the War: two years of bravery, two years of sacrifice" placed on the windows of Museum of the Occupation of Latvia in the Old Town of Riga.

The photo exhibition was opened this year on February 24 – the day of commemoration of Russia's full invasion of Ukraine. It was prepared by the Press Service of the National Guard of Ukraine and its photographers in cooperation with the Polonsky Family Foundation.

The State Police will initiate criminal proceedings against the person suspected of the crime. This was just another attack on the Museum this year.
